Senses ultrasonic amplitude changes and guards against unplanned downtime and product loss! By detecting changes of ultrasonic amplitude the Ultra-Trak 750™ provides early warning of: • Mechanical failure • Valve leakage • Flow disruption • Internal arcing/partial discharge Reap benefits from the moment you install the Ultra-Trak 750™, as it passively monitors ultrasounds pro uced by operating equipment. d Ultra-Trak 750™ is easily connected to alarms or recorders for data log ging because of its 4-20 mA current output, coupled with a demodulated output. The rugged Ultra-Trak 750™ is housed in stainless steel. Because it’s water resistant and dust proof, it can be exer ally mounted in practically any t n chalenging environment. Coupled with a wide l dynamic range of 120 dB and sensitivity djustment, this sen or is ready to meet your most demanding s sensing needs. Monitor cavitation, bearings, and valves
